Origins

Since 1997 Operation Africa has had a dream to reach military groups and armies of Africa for Jesus Christ.

Birthed out of the “Youth Alive - World Target Teams” trip to Zimbabwe in 1997, Operation Africa sought to evangelise troops that are often feared, hated and marginalised by their own people.





Our Promise: “Bibles for African Soldiers”

Previously thought unreachable by Christian organizations, the soldiers and members of defence forces are often killed by war and disease. Operation Africa wants to see soldiers and members of Africa’s military groups reached by those who love God to see our vision realised:

Vision: “Every African soldier honoured before God’s throne”
               (Revelation 7:9, 20: 11-15)

 

Started by the Reverend Jason Greive of Queensland, Australia the first missions project was in Zimbabwe, on the African continent.

Operation Africa struck a memorandum of understanding with the Queensland Bible Society to partner with us to supply camouflage or “cammo” bibles in military colours so that the soldiers have ownership of their bible. It is the distribution of bibles that is our core mission:

 

Mission: “To distribute God’s word, preach God’s gospel, and                    demonstrate God’s love to the soldiers of Africa”
